cache: drop unused set_value - it is handled by cache.get_value by calling createfunc

    def __iter__(self):
 
        """override __iter__ to pull results from Beaker
 
           if particular attributes have been configured.
 

	
 
           Note that this approach does *not* detach the loaded objects from
 
           the current session. If the cache backend is an in-process cache
 
           (like "memory") and lives beyond the scope of the current session's
 
           transaction, those objects may be expired. The method here can be
 
           modified to first expunge() each loaded item from the current
 
           session before returning the list of items, so that the items
 
           in the cache are not the same ones in the current Session.
 

	
 
        """
 
        if hasattr(self, '_cache_parameters'):
 
            return self.get_value(createfunc=lambda:
 
                                  list(Query.__iter__(self)))
 
        else:
 
            return Query.__iter__(self)
 

	
 
    def invalidate(self):
 
        """Invalidate the value represented by this Query."""
 

	
 
        cache, cache_key = _get_cache_parameters(self)
 
        cache.remove(cache_key)
 

	
 
    def get_value(self, merge=True, createfunc=None):
 
        """Return the value from the cache for this query.
 

	
 
        Raise KeyError if no value present and no
 
        createfunc specified.
 

	
 
        """
 
        cache, cache_key = _get_cache_parameters(self)
 
        ret = cache.get_value(cache_key, createfunc=createfunc)
 
        if merge:
 
            ret = self.merge_result(ret, load=False)
 
        return ret
 

	
 
    def set_value(self, value):
 
        """Set the value in the cache for this query."""
 

	
 
        cache, cache_key = _get_cache_parameters(self)
 
        cache.put(cache_key, value)

def _get_cache_parameters(query):
 
    """For a query with cache_region and cache_namespace configured,
 
    return the corresponding Cache instance and cache key, based
 
    on this query's current criterion and parameter values.
 

	
 
    """
 
    if not hasattr(query, '_cache_parameters'):
 
        raise ValueError("This Query does not have caching "
 
                         "parameters configured.")
 

	
 
    region, namespace, cache_key = query._cache_parameters
 

	
 
    namespace = _namespace_from_query(namespace, query)
 

	
 
    if cache_key is None:
 
        # cache key - the value arguments from this query's parameters.
 
        args = _params_from_query(query)
 
        args.append(query._limit)
 
        args.append(query._offset)
 
        cache_key = " ".join(str(x) for x in args)
 

	
 
    if cache_key is None:
 
        raise Exception('Cache key cannot be None')
 

	
 
    # get cache
 
    #cache = query.cache_manager.get_cache_region(namespace, region)
 
    cache = get_cache_region(namespace, region)
 
    # optional - hash the cache_key too for consistent length
 
    # import uuid
 
    # cache_key= str(uuid.uuid5(uuid.NAMESPACE_DNS, cache_key))
 

	
 
    return cache, cache_key
